Elis Qualify to Defend National Championship

April 25, 2005

With a second place finish at the Women's New England Championships, or Reed Trophy, the Yale women's sailing team qualified for the ICSA/Gill Women's North American Championships. Last season, the Elis won the regatta to become the top women's team in college sailing.

With 103 points, the Bulldogs finished second to Harvard at the Reed. The top four teams earn automatic berths to the nationals.

In the A division, Molly Carapiet and alternating crews Jenn Hoyle and Julie Papanek sailed to a second place finish overall with 51 points that included three first place finishes.

The Elis also finished second in the B division, as the trio of Emily Hill, Meghan Pearl, and Kendra Emhiser switched off to grab four first place finishes and a total of 52 points.

The North Americans will be hosted by the University of Texas and held at the Austin Yacht Club on Lake Travis from June 1-3.
